Are you using the right messaging for your buyer journey? The path from research to purchasing in the B2B space is long and winding. On top of this, there is the added complication that a B2B buyer rarely travels this path alone. In today’s hyper-competitive environment, buyers are carrying out research up to 18 months before talking to sales. If you don’t know where your prospect is on the buying journey, the chances are your messaging isn’t resonating with them.

Another new year approaches and, with it, another major data privacy regulation takes effect. This time, it’s the California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A), which becomes law on January 1, 2020. Don’t be fooled into thinking that only California companies need pay attention. Most digital marketers strive to deliver a consistent omnichannel experience to their customers. However, new research shows that many are still struggling to achieve this primary objective. Selligent recently surveyed 221 digital marketers to gauge their omnichannel excellence. Statistics showed that the majority of respondents (47 percent) were “neutral” when asked how easy or difficult it is for them to launch integrated omnichannel campaigns across their marketing channels.
